
Two people were convicted at Newry Magistrates’ Court today for claiming benefits they were not entitled to.
Sanda Varga (35) of Chapel Street, Newry, claimed Universal Credit totalling £3,064 whilst failing to declare a change in joint living arrangements.
She was sentenced to four months imprisonment suspended for two years.
Dorel Varga (34) of St Malachy’s Park, Camlough, claimed Universal Credit totalling £3,064 whilst failing to declare a change in joint living arrangements.
He was sentenced to four months imprisonment suspended for two years.
Both are also required to repay any outstanding money wrongfully obtained to the Department for Communities.
